Commercial fire alarm triggers at six-story apartment building, Castle Rock CO
Heads up: This post was detected from real-time dispatch audio. Information may be incomplete, and the situation may evolve. Always verify using official agency releases.
A commercial fire alarm activated at The View, a six-story apartment building near Jerry Street in Castle Rock, Colorado. Fire crews responded and established command while investigating the alarm with horns and strobes activated.
